Jersey Bulls were held to a frustrating 0-0 draw away at Horley Town in Combined Counties Premier South.

Fraser Barlow, James Sunley, and Lorne Bickley all had chances for the Bulls in a goalless first half.

The islanders felt they should have had a penalty 11 minutes from full time when Bickley appeared to be fouled by Horley goalkeeper George Hyde.

Bulls had an effort cleared off the line in stoppage time as they failed to score for the first time since the end of March.

The point maintains the island side's unbeaten run under new manager Elliot Powell after two wins and two draws in their first four matches.
